The cheapest way to get from North Vancouver to Los Angeles is to bus which costs $200 - $400 and takes 32h 20m.
The fastest way to get from North Vancouver to Los Angeles is to ferry and fly which takes 6h 30m and costs $100 - $850.
No, there is no direct bus from North Vancouver to Los Angeles station. However, there are services departing from Lonsdale Quay and arriving at Los Angeles Union Station via Vancouver, Seattle Bus Station and Sacramento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 32h 20m.
The distance between North Vancouver and Los Angeles is 1115 miles. The road distance is 1285.2 miles.
The best way to get from North Vancouver to Los Angeles without a car is to bus which takes 32h 20m and costs $200 - $400.
It takes approximately 6h 30m to get from North Vancouver to Los Angeles, including transfers.
